WWE Raw Review – June 19, 2023

Kicking off this week’s Raw with Finn Balor blindsides World Heavyweight Champion Seth Rollins as he basks in the song of the fans. He dumps him out of the ring then sends him crashing into the announce table spine 1st. He tosses him into the ring post then rains down right hands and fires off several stomps. Adam Pearce and other officials run down to check on Rollins and pull him off Rollins but Balor escapes their grasp and hits the Coup De Grace off the ring steps. He delivers a 2nd one off the announce table before landing another one off the ring steps & we go to a break.

After the break we see Rollins &  Pearce walking around backstage. Balor blindsides him once again and throws a table on top of him then sends him crashing into a road case and stomps on his neck then he tells Rollins he’s been waiting 7 years to get his hands on him and it’s his time now. He finally backs down and Pearce and other officials check on Rollins.

Back at ringside The Miz is in the ring & says Rollins offered up an open challenge for the World Heavyweight Title that he was going to accept but that can no longer happen as a result of what just happened so he issued his own open challenge and Tommaso Ciampa answers the call in his return to WWE.

Tommaso Ciampa vs. The Miz

Tommaso Ciampa clocks The Miz before the bell rings and he fires off stomps in the corner before the action spills to the outside and Ciampa sends Miz face first into the announce table then tosses him back inside the ring and delivers a pair of splashes in the corner then delivers a leaping clothesline. Miz responds with a DDT and goes for a pin but Ciampa kicks out.

Ciampa then delivers a pair of chops before Miz lands a boot and a few kicks on Ciampa’s midsection then whips Ciampa into the corner and ascends to the top rope but Ciampa catches him with a running knee follow by Fairy Tale Ending for the win.

Winner: Tommaso Ciampa

Matt Riddle vs. Ludwig Kaiser

Match starts off with a lock up then Matt Riddle fires off a couple of kicks on his chest then cinches in an Ankle Lock but Ludwig Kaiser quickly escapes by grabbing the bottom rope before he lands a dropkick. Riddle fires back with a pair of gutwrench suplexes and a Broton.

The action spills to the outside and Riddle delivers a knee off the apron then he gets in Gunther’s face allowing Kaiser to sneak up on him and lands a chop block before planting him on the floor off of the apron as we go to a break.

After the break Kaiser teeters on the top rope then Riddle meets him up there and lands a superplex before they go back & forth with right hands. Riddle lands Sole Food and a forearm then looks for a standing moonsault. Kaiser moves out of the way and Riddle looks for another Broton but Kaiser gets his knees up.

He dumps Kaiser to the outside and lands the Floating Bro then gets him back in the ring and hits a fisherman’s buster. Kaiser fires back with an uppercut and an enziguri but Riddle lands a ripcord knee.

Kaiser delivers another enziguri and a double underhook suplex then looks for an uppercut off the middle rope before Riddle catches him with a German suplex mid air then lands the Bro Derek for the win.

Winner: Matt Riddle

After the match Gunther attacks Riddle. He plants him & Kaiser joins in & he rains down right hands before Gunther targets his leg and stomps on it.

6 Man Tag Team Match
Undisputed WWE Tag Team Champions Kevin Owens & Sami Zayn & Cody Rhodes vs. Judgement Day (Damian Priest, Finn Balor & Dominik Mysterio)

Match starts off with Cody Rhodes & Finn Balor lock up then Balor delivers a back elbow but Rhodes gets him up on his shoulders and plants him. Dominik Mysterio tags in but slides out of the ring and taunts Rhodes then he gets back inside and tags out to Damian Priest as Rhodes does the same to Sami Zayn.

Priest fires off stomps on Zayn in the corner but Zayn responds with an elbow drop off the middle rope. Mysterio tags in and Zayn fires off right hands. Dominik sets up for 3 Amigos but Zayn reverses the momentum into a suplex of his own & that takes us to a break.

After the break Priest delivers a back elbow to Zayn then Balor tags in then immediately tags out to Priest. Balor delivers a backbreaker before holding him in place. Priest then delivers a leg drop. He charges at Zayn in the corner but Zayn ducks out of the way. Balor tags in and Zayn catches him with a clothesline.

Kevin Owens & Mysterio tag in. Owens fires off stomps before Mysterio rolls out of the ring. Owens blindsides him with a clothesline to the back of his neck then tosses him back in the ring and lands a superkick then follows it up with a cannonball and Balor makes the blind tag. He executes an elbow drop but Owens responds with a superkick and tags in Rhodes.

Priest tags in and Rhodes lands a scoop powerslam then follows it up with a Disaster Kick but Priest fires back with South Of Heaven and goes for a pin but Zayn breaks the fall. Mysterio blindsides him but Zayn dumps him out of the ring. Rhea Ripley catches him and gets in Zayn’s face before Zayn goes flying and takes Mysterio out on the outside after Ripley ducks out of the way.

Back in the ring Rhodes lands Cody Cutter then follows it up with a back elbow and Mysterio tries to interfere but Zayn catches him with a Helluva Kick and Owens hits a Stunner. Rhodes then hits Cross Rhodes on Priest for the win.

Winners: Undisputed WWE Tag Team Champions Kevin Owens & Sami Zayn & Cody Rhodes
